What is a twist drill?

A twist drill is one of the most widely used tools for creating accurate holes across general engineering, maintenance, OEM production and workshop applications. Addison offers a broad range of HSS twist drill bit options designed for dependable cutting, stable hole quality and efficient chip evacuation across different materials and machining conditions.

Twist drill parts and geometry

The performance of a drill depends on its design, material and geometry. Key twist drill parts such as the point, flute, web, land, shank and cutting edge all influence how the tool enters the material, removes chips and maintains accuracy. Understanding twist drill angle, flute design and overall geometry of twist drill helps users choose the right tool for better tool life, smoother cutting and consistent results.
